Morphological Analysis bekhol {בְּכֹ֥ל | bə-ḵōl}: in all (preposition bə + noun kol • masculine singular construct) • asher-hithalakti {אֲשֶֽׁר־הִתְהַלַּכְתִּי֮ | ʾăšer-hit·hal·lak·tî}: where I walked about (relative particle ʾăšer + verb • Hitpael perfect • first person common singular) • bekhol-yisrael {בְּכָל־יִשְׂרָאֵל֒ | bə-ḵāl-yiśrāʾēl}: throughout all Israel (preposition bə + noun kol • masculine singular construct + proper noun) • hadavar {הֲדָבָ֣ר | hă-dāḇār}: a word (interrogative heh prefix + noun • masculine singular absolute) • dibbarti {דִּבַּ֗רְתִּי | dibbar·tî}: I spoke (verb • Piel perfect • first person common singular) • et-ahad {אֶת־אַחַד֙ | ʾeṯ-ʾaḥaḏ}: one (direct object marker ʾet + numeral • masculine singular) • shoptei {שֹׁפְטֵ֣י | šōp̄ṭê}: judges of (noun • masculine plural construct) • yisrael {יִשְׂרָאֵ֔ל | yiśrāʾēl}: Israel (proper noun • masculine singular) • asher {אֲשֶׁ֥ר | ʾăšer}: whom (relative particle) • tsiviti {צִוִּ֛יתִי | ṣiwwî·tî}: I commanded (verb • Piel perfect • first person common singular) • lirʿot {לִרְע֥וֹת | lirʿōṯ}: to shepherd (verb • Qal infinitive construct) • et-ammi {אֶת־עַמִּ֖י | ʾeṯ-ʿammî}: my people (direct object marker ʾet + noun ʿam • masculine singular collective + first person common singular suffix) • lemor {לֵאמֹ֑ר | lēʾmōr}: saying (verb • Qal infinitive construct used to introduce direct speech) • lammah {לָ֛מָּה | lām·māh}: why (interrogative adverb) • lo-venitem {לֹא־בְנִיתֶ֥ם | lō-ḇənîṯem}: you have not built (negative particle + verb • Qal perfect • second person masculine plural) • li {לִ֖י | lî}: for Me (preposition lə + first person common singular suffix) • bet {בֵּ֥ית | bêṯ}: house of (noun • masculine singular construct) • arazim {אֲרָזִֽים | ʾărāzîm}: cedars (noun • masculine plural absolute) |
